Preparations and Security Measures
Delhi is gearing up for the BRICS Summit with heightened security protocols. Anti-drone systems have been installed at strategic locations, including routes around Indira Gandhi International and Palam airports, hotels, the event venue, and other sensitive areas. Additional Commissioner of Police Traffic Dinesh Kumar Gupta confirmed these measures aim to maintain close vigilance over the skies during the summit.
The summit’s security arrangements reflect the importance of the event, which brings together leaders from member countries and partner nations. The focus is on ensuring a secure environment for high-profile bilateral and multilateral discussions.
